Subject: EXIF scrubbing cut-over complete

Team — the PixelRinse scrubbing service is now live on the new pipeline as of last night. All uploads route through the scrubber before storage; the legacy inline stripper is disabled but not yet removed. Rollback is a single flag flip if needed. No anomalies in the first twelve hours. The production settings now in effect are listed below.

settings of tagef-bawif:
DRUIX_HOST=druix.zemvarlabs.internal
DRUIX_PORT=8000

## Artifact Signing: Order-Cutoff Rule

The Ovenlight bakery service enforces a 4 p.m. order cutoff, and the cutoff ruleset ships as a signed artifact. Release managers must re-sign the ruleset on every change; unsigned rules are ignored at runtime. Verification uses the current signing key, reproduced here for convenience.

rollout seal: bky13_zMSdroAXJPwnP

## Idempotency Keys for Payment Retries (Lumopay)

Every retry of a charge request must reuse the original idempotency key; generating a new key on retry can produce duplicate charges. Keys are scoped per merchant and expire after 48 hours. Reviewers should verify keys are derived server-side, never from client input. The full key-generation specification and threat model are maintained on the internal page.

dashboard of kaguf-tawip = https://vault.merlaqsys.test/issue